Margarita Braves Release Pitcher Jonaiker Villalobos: What’s Next for the Lefty?

The Margarita Braves have made an early off-season move in the Liga Venezolana de Béisbol Profesional (LVBP), releasing left-handed pitcher Jonaiker Villalobos. This opens the door for the 25-year-old Maracaibo native to possibly sign with any team in Venezuela or the Caribbean League.

While the LVBP transaction wire is always active, the period for player changes had been paused between mid-December and late January. With the transaction window now open since January 27th, the Braves acted swiftly.

Villalobos, known for his strikeout ability, has spent his entire LVBP career with the Margarita Braves. He was initially with the Leones del Caracas, who traded him to the island team in 2021.

Villalobos’s Path: From Marlins Prospect to Independent Ball

Villalobos originally signed with the Miami Marlins organization. However, his career, like many minor leaguers, was impacted by the COVID-19 pandemic, leading to his release after the cancellation of the 2020 minor league season.During his time in the Marlins system, he posted a 6-4 record with 3 saves and a 4.55 ERA across rookie and Class A levels.

In his 2021-2022 campaign with the margarita Braves, Villalobos recorded a 4.05 ERA in 6 appearances. after his release from the Marlins, he found a home in the Frontier League, an independent baseball circuit. In 2024, he pitched 110 innings across 20 starts, racking up an remarkable 95 strikeouts while issuing 30 walks, with a 4.99 ERA.

Interestingly, instead of pitching in the LVBP after his Frontier League stint, Villalobos opted to play for the Caimanes de Barranquilla in the Colombian Professional Baseball League.

What is the LVBP?

The Liga Venezolana de Béisbol Profesional (LVBP) is the top professional baseball league in Venezuela,operating during the winter season. It attracts talented players from Venezuela and other countries. The LVBP is a popular league with a rich history, offering a competitive platform for baseball players.

What is the significance of the Venezuelan Winter League?

The Venezuelan Winter League, as the LVBP is often called, serves multiple purposes. It gives Venezuelan players a chance to hone their skills, provides opportunities for international players to demonstrate their abilities, helps scouts and general managers from MLB and other leagues to evaluate talent, and keeps baseball alive and thriving in Venezuela during the offseason. It also offers a crucial pathway for players to get noticed and possibly move on to bigger leagues and more lucrative careers.
